弱空间式Locale和Locale的反射性

【作者】 孙向荣

【导师】 贺伟;

【作者基本信息】 南京师范大学 , 基础数学, 2007, 博士

【摘要】 本文对locale范畴的乘积保持性以及反射性进行了研究,得到的主要结果如下:1.引入弱空间式locale的定义,证明弱空间式locale范畴WSloc为范畴Loc的余反射满子范畴,弱空间式locale的乘积是弱空间式的。给出了弱空间式locale的一组等价刻画。特别地,证明了一个locale A是空间式的当且仅当它的核映射localeN(A)是弱空间式的;一个空间式locale的每一个子locale都是空间式的当且仅当它的每一个子locale是弱空间式的。最后,证明了弱空间式性在定向函子下保持不变。2.在locale中引入正则元,完全正则元以及零维元的概念,构造性的给出了任意locale的正则反射,完全正则反射以及零维反射的描述。对于满足‘(?)’关系插入性的locale,证明了弱正则元与正则元等价,给出其更好形式的正则反射构造。进一步,利用平稳(flat)子locale的扩张引理给出了locale的紧正则反射,紧完全正则反射以及紧零维反射的构造性描述。3.对于正规locale,给出其Banaschewski-Mulvey形式的紧正则反射,并证明其与Johnstone形式的Wallman紧化一致,从而推广了Johnstone在文献[]中的主要结果。进一步讨论其与前一章得到的紧正则反射之间的关系,证明了A的理想格上的正则元就是A的正则理想,说明了几种正则紧反射构造的等价性。4.对于满足‘(?)’关系插入性的locale,运用前一章得到的紧正则反射,证明了满足插入性的可紧化locale的紧正则反射保持和反射连通性。因正规locale满足插入性,推广了B.Banascewski的相关结果,部分解决了文献[21]的一个问题。5.引入限制反射子范畴的定义。证明了:若范畴B是A在范畴C上的限制反射子范畴,范畴C是B的反射子范畴,则范畴C是A的反射子范畴,即给出更弱形式的反射子范畴的复合定理。

【Abstract】 In this dissertation, we investigate some properties on locales. The main results are summarized as follows.1. The concept of weakly spatial locale is presented. We show that the category WSLoc of weakly spatial locales is a coreflective subcategory of the category Loc and the localic product of weakly spatial locale is still weakly spatial. Moreover, we show that a locale A is spatial if and only if the nucleus locale N(A) is weakly spatial. Every sublocale of a locale A is spatial if and only if every sublocale of A is weakly spatial. Also we prove that the weekly spatiality is preserved by directed functors.2. By introducing regular elements, completely regular elements and zero-dimensiomal elements, we give constructive descriptions of the completely regular reflection and the zero-dimensional reflection of locales in much simple form. For a locale A, which satisfies the subdivisibility property, we show that the locale R(A) of regular elements is the regular reflection of A. Furthermore, we obtain the compact regular reflection, the completely regular reflection and the compact zero-dimensional reflection of locales by the extension lemma of flat sulocale.3. For normal locales, we prove that the Banaschewski-Mulvey’s compact regular reflection construction of locales is isomorphisc to the Johnstone Wallman com-pcactification of locales. We show that a subfit semi-normal locale is normal, but the converse is not true in general. Furthermore, we generalized the main result in[76].4. By applying the compact regular reflection construction of locales given in the former chapter, we show that the compact regular reflection preserves and reflects connectedness for compactifiable locales, which satisfies the subdivisibility property.5. we give a weakly form of the composition theorem of reflectors.
